Factor the client-side skew handshake into a shared core helper (quic::clock_sync -> ClockSkew) so both the reference client and the embeddable connector use one implementation. NativeClient now runs the handshake at connect (right after Start, before the control task takes the stream) and stores the host-client offset; it's read over the C ABI via punktfunk_connection_clock_offset_ns (i64 ns, host minus client; 0 = no correction / old host). This is the substrate the Apple client needs for the decode->present (glass-to- glass) term: stamp present time, add the offset to express it in the host's capture clock, subtract the AU pts_ns. client-rs drops its local clock_sync copy and uses the shared helper (behavior unchanged; validated locally).
